Ohio State AD Gene Smith ‘not 100 percent comfortable’ with playing college football
One way to tell where college football season may stand right now is to look for the comments of some of the sport’s biggest power brokers.
Ohio State athletic director Gene Smith is one of those people. He said Wednesday that, as of now, he’s still wary of playing college football, but added that his feelings could change.
Gene Smith on his comfort level playing football this year: "I'm not 100 percent comfortable yet. That's one of the things with this process, you constantly get educated. I'm hopeful that I'm going to reach 100 percent comfort, but I'm not there yet."
